    12: Anabolic Steroids - Bionabol
    It is actually in Bulgaria where Bionabol was produced by a company called Balkanpharma, although it is medically known as methandrostenolone. The Bionabol steroids were ceased to be produced back in 2005 although anything that is still available doesn't expire until 2009. The reason was it's discontinuation was due to the Bulgarian Ministry of Health who around that time decided to tighten up on steroid production.
